How Our Commercial Water Extraction Process Works
Water extraction is a delicate process that needs the right equipment and expertise to get it done right. Our team has developed a comprehensive process to ensure your business is back up and running in no time. We’ll start by assessing the damage to find out the extent of the water damage and create a plan to tackle it. Next, our industrial-grade water extractors will be put to work to remove the standing water, followed by HEPA air scrubbers to remove any lingering moisture and contaminants. Finally, we’ll dry the area using specialized equipment to prevent further damage and ensure your property is safe to occupy.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a certified technician to your property to assess the damage and find out the best course of action. This will involve identifying the source of the leak and creating a customized plan to tackle the water dam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using our industrial-grade water extractors, we’ll remove the standing water from your property, including up to 2 inches of standing water from your floors and walls.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ry the affected area, including HEPA air scrubbers to remove any lingering moisture and contaminants.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
Our technicians will thoroughly clean and disinfect the area to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.

Commercial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Pro
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Visible water damage or leaks | Yes | No | DIY can help with minor water damage, but for larger leaks or extensive water damage, it’s best to call a pro. |
| Hidden water damage or leaks | No | Yes | Hidden water damage can be difficult to detect and may need specialized equipment to identify and repair. |
| Large or extensive water damage | No | Yes | Large or extensive water damage can be costly to repair and may need specialized equipment and expertise to fix. |
| Water damage in sensitive areas (e.g. Electrical, HVAC) | No | Yes | Water damage in sensitive areas can be hazardous and needs specialized equipment and expertise to repair safely. |
| Water damage with visible mold or mildew | No | Yes | Visible mold or mildew can be a sign of a larger issue and needs specialized equipment and expertise to remove and prevent future growth. |

Commercial Water Extraction Cost in North Port, FL
The cost of commercial water extraction services can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Planning | $500-$1,500 | Size and complexity of the job, location, and accessibility |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$2,000-$5,000 | Size of the affected area, type of equipment required, and labor costs |
| HEPA Air Scrubbing and Dehumidification | $1,000-$3,000 | Size of the affected area, type of equipment required, and labor costs |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$500-$2,000 | Size of the affected area, type of equipment required, and labor costs |
| More Services (e.g. Demolition, reconstruction) | Varies | Size and complexity of the job, labor costs, and materials required |
